Cook pasta in lots of water.
-
2
Leave pasta al denta.
-
3
Drain rince and cool.
-
4
Fry chopped onion in a little oil.
-
5
Leave firm to bite.
-
6
Add 2 tins of chopped tomatoes to onions and simmer.
-
7
Add garlic powder, basil, suger and salt / pepper to mix, simmer for 5 mins on low heat.
-
8
Taste and season to taste.
-
9
Put tin of sweetcorn and 2 tins of tuna in large mixing bowl.
-
10
After tomato mix has simmered add to mixing bowl and mix together.
-
11
Leave to stand for 15 mins+
-
12
Add cooked carrots to mix.
-
13
After pasta has drained add to bowl mix together.
-
14
Leave for at least 3 hours for pasta to soak up juices.
-
15
If pasta has soaked up all the juices and the mix is stiff and dry add passata or more tomatos to loosen.
-
16
Remember you are going to bake it later.
-
17
Put mix into oven dish or dishes fill to just below the top.
-
18
Grate cheese on top to cover and bake untill cheese golden brown on 200 c Serve with green salad and garlic bread or chill and freeze.
-
19
Keeps well in fridge or freezer.
-
20
Microwave to reheat.
-
21
This is the basic recipe but there are lots of variations such as cream cheese stirred into mix before cheese top go's on.
-
22
Also replace tuna with cooked bacon and fresh cherry tomatoes, and or chicken.
-
23
Also mix bread crumbs with cheese for crunchy top or cheese and onion crisps crumbled on top and then cheese.
-
24
You can add peppers to mix and or peas and herbs and spices to your taste.
-
25
Also my favorite is a layer of cheese sauce on top and then grated cheese.
-
26
Cheap nutritional and taste great.
